The best response that compares the reactions of the Byzantine and Sasanian Empires to Islamic conquest is:

The Sasanians crumbled due to instability, the Byzantines held out despite losing territory.

This response accurately reflects the historical context: the Sasanian Empire was significantly weakened by internal strife and external pressures, leading to its rapid decline after the rise of Islam. Meanwhile, although the Byzantine Empire lost significant territories, it was able to maintain some degree of stability and resilience over the centuries that followed, despite facing ongoing challenges from Islamic forces.
